摘要
针对延安产的青蒿(Artemisia carvifolia)和白蒿(Herba artimisiae sieversianae)2种植物,采取水蒸气蒸馏法提取其挥发油,采用菌丝生长速率法及96孔板法检测挥发油的抑菌活性,结果表明:当浓度是2.0 mg/mL时,青蒿挥发油对9种被测植物病原真菌的抑制作用均较差,对油菜菌核(Sclerotinia sclerotioru)活性最好,也仅为57.30%;白蒿挥发油对受试真菌的抑制作用较强,对人参锈腐菌(Cylindrocarpon destructans)、梨黑星病(Venturia nashicola)、烟草赤星病菌(Alternaria alternata)的抑制率均达到90%以上;2种精油除了对大肠杆菌(Escherichia coli)表现出较弱的抑制活性外,对于其他受试菌均无活性,其最小抑菌浓度(MIC)均为500 mg/mL。采用气相色谱-质谱联用仪(GC-MS)分析了2种蒿挥发油的主要化学成分,结果从青蒿中鉴定出26种化合物,其中含量最多的为石竹烯氧化物(25.75%);从白蒿中鉴定出49种化合物,萘嵌戊烷含量最高(30.37%),分析结果显示延安产2种蒿挥发油的主要成分和含量与其他产地的差异较大。白蒿挥发油具有显著的抑菌活性,具备开发为绿色杀菌剂的潜力。
Volatile oils were extracted from two Artemisia species of Yan’an by steam distillation.Antifungal and antibacteria activities were measured by mycelium growth rate and96well plate method.The results showed that at the concentration of2.0mg/mL,the antifungal activity of Artemisia stelleriana oil was weak and the highest inhibition rate was only57.3%against Sclerotinia sclerotioru.Volatile oil of Herba artimisiae sieversianae showed significant antifungal activity against9tested fungus and inhibition rates reached above90%against Cylindrocarpon destructans,Venturia nashicola,Alternaria alternata.Antibacterial activities of the oils were not observed except for Escherichia coli and inhibition rates were500mg/mL.Chemical components of volatile oils were analyzed and determined by gas chromatography-mass spectrum.26compounds were indentified from A.carvifolia oil.The most content was caryophyllene oxide and the content reached25.75%.49compounds were indentified from H.artimisiae sieversianae and the highest contest of penylene pentane was30.37%.The result showed volatile oil of H.artimisiae sieversianae had potential to be developed as new type green fungicide agents.
